Background technique
Chair is the essential furniture of people's life office, when weather is warmmer, sitting be easy it is awfully hot, due to human body with Seat has biggish contact area, and the temperature at this will be not easy discharge and human body is caused to have feeling of oppression and heat, or even perspire, and reduce The comfort of seat.Currently, have being aerated in such a way that seat bottom installs fan to seat, but the wind of fan Stream is difficult the foam-rubber cushion by seat, and therefore, aeration-cooling the effect is unsatisfactory.

When specifically used, first the chamber door of portions cavity is opened, by the guide protrusions 64 of support plate 41 along support box body 6 Guide groove 61 insertion until support plate 41 limit inserted block 65 insertion support box body 6 limited mouth 63 in, at this time support plate 41 with It supports box body 6 fixed, is then switched off the chamber door of portions cavity, the chamber door of portions cavity is equipped with a jack, by air supply pipe one One end is inserted into along jack and is connect with the gas supply end 45 of air supply header 44, the switch of portions ventilation is then opened, at this point, air pump 3 And solenoid valve one is opened, air pump 3 generates distinguished and admirable total into air supply header 44, then by supplying by solenoid valve one and air supply pipe one Pipe 44 is divided into gas supply pipe 42, is then entered inside support box body 6 by the venthole 46 of gas supply pipe 42, finally by supporting The venthole 62 of box body 6 penetrates seat 1, to play to the effect of 1 heat dissipation ventilation of seat.The knot of the backventing part of the chair back 2 Structure and application method are identical as seat 1.

As shown in figure 5, the solenoid valve one is identical as two structure of solenoid valve.The solenoid valve one includes solenoid valve sheet Body, the solenoid valve body are equipped with cavity, and the air intake 51 being connected to the cavity and gas outlet 52, set in the cavity There is sliding plug 54, the mobile bar 55 of the sliding plug 54 is installed, described 55 one end of mobile bar is connect with magnetic block 56, the cavity It is inside additionally provided with magnetic plate 57, connecting spring 58 is equipped between the magnetic plate 57 and the magnetic block 56.
Air intake 51 is connect with air pump, and gas outlet 52 is connect with air supply pipe one, when solenoid valve is opened, that is, when being powered, and magnetic Since the effect of coil and iron core generates magnetic force, magnetic block 56 is connect after compressing connecting spring 58 with magnetic plate 57 plate 57, thus Make mobile bar 55 that sliding plug 54 be driven to move up, air intake 51 is connected to gas outlet 52, at this point, the generation of air pump 3 is distinguished and admirable Cavity is entered by air intake 51, then air supply pipe one is entered by gas outlet 52.When solenoid valve closing, i.e. no power, magnetic plate 57 Magnetic force disappears, and magnetic block 56 drives connecting spring 58 to reset by gravity, makes mobile bar 55 that sliding plug 54 be driven to move down, It will be blocked between air intake 51 and gas outlet 52.
As shown in Figure 6 and Figure 7, it is equipped between the air supply opening and the solenoid valve one and the solenoid valve two of the air pump 3 Semiconductor refrigerating part 7, the semiconductor refrigerating part 7 include ring body 71, the refrigeration set on the 71 inner ring side of ring body End and heating end set on 71 outer rim side of ring body, and the radiating fin set on 71 outer rim side of ring body 72.When needing distinguished and admirable refrigeration, semiconductor refrigerating part 7 can be opened, the distinguished and admirable refrigeration end for flowing through 71 inner ring side of ring body Shi Bianleng further improves the radiating and cooling effect of chair.The radiating end of 71 outer rim side of ring body passes through radiating fin 72 Heat is removed.

When specific installation, elastic buffering pad 82 is first placed in shockproof 81 top of frame, then will be prevented by attachment screw 85 Shake frame 81 is connect with the nut body of seat 1, and the length of nut body is not less than 3 centimetres, so that attachment screw 85 and nut body Screw thread sufficiently connects, so that shockproof frame 81 and 1 stable connection of seat are secured.Then, air pump 3 is penetrated in shockproof chamber, and made The limited block 83 of air pump shell bottom is directed at the limit opening of shockproof 81 bottom of frame, and limited block 83 is inserted into limit opening In, play the role of Horizontal limiting to air pump 3.Then, stop screw 84 is mounted on limited block 83, height is played to air pump 3 Position-limiting action.Followed by, by elastic buffer body 86 be placed in it is shockproof intracavitary and by elastic buffer body limit plate by elastic buffer body 86 limits are fixed.Shockproof frame 81 with this configuration can weaken generated vibration when air pump 3 works significantly.
Air pump 3 uses small silent air pump, and air pump 3 is also equipped with muffler, further reduced and make an uproar caused by air pump 3 Sound.
